
So, you’ve got this fantastic idea for an Android app swirling around in your head, and you’re a Python enthusiast, armed with solid core Python knowledge. The burning question is: can you actually bring that app to life using Python on Android? Let’s dive in and explore the possibilities and pathways!
Can I install Python on Android? – Techris Innovation Hub
The short answer is yes, you *can* run Python on Android. However, it’s not as straightforward as simply installing Python directly onto your phone or tablet. Android’s operating system is built around Java (or Kotlin), not Python. This means you’ll need a bridge, a way to translate your Python code into something Android can understand and execute.
One common approach involves using tools like Kivy or BeeWare Toga. Kivy, for instance, is a Python framework specifically designed for creating multi-touch applications, including those on Android. It allows you to write your app’s logic in Python while providing cross-platform support. BeeWare Toga, on the other hand, aims to provide native look-and-feel on different platforms, including Android, using a Python codebase.
These frameworks essentially handle the translation layer, converting your Python code into the native Android components. They offer widgets, layouts, and other functionalities that mimic the standard Android UI elements. While these frameworks are powerful, keep in mind that they might have a learning curve. You’ll need to familiarize yourself with their specific APIs and functionalities. Core Python is a great start but framework specific knowledge is key.
Another option involves using environments like Termux. Termux is essentially an Android terminal emulator that allows you to install Linux packages, including Python. This approach is more command-line oriented and might be suitable if you’re comfortable working in a terminal environment. While you can technically run Python scripts in Termux, it’s typically not the ideal route for creating full-fledged Android applications with graphical user interfaces. It’s more useful for running backend processes or utility scripts on your Android device.
Run Python On Android – How To Run Python Programs On Android
It’s important to understand that developing Android apps with Python, especially if you only have core Python knowledge, typically involves more than just writing Python code. You’ll also need to consider things like packaging your application, managing dependencies, and creating a user interface that’s both functional and visually appealing.
Deployment is another crucial aspect. After developing your app, you’ll need to package it into an APK (Android Package Kit) file, which is the standard format for Android applications. The frameworks mentioned earlier usually provide tools for simplifying this process. You’ll also need to sign your APK before distributing it, ensuring the authenticity and integrity of your application.
In summary, developing Android apps using Python with just core Python knowledge is definitely achievable, but it requires using specific tools and frameworks designed to bridge the gap between Python and the Android operating system. Be prepared to learn new technologies and adapt your skillset. While it might seem challenging initially, the rewards of creating your own Android app using your Python skills can be incredibly fulfilling. Good luck on your app development journey!
If you are searching about sl4a – Python Tutorial you’ve came to the right page. We have 10 Images about sl4a – Python Tutorial like sl4a – Python Tutorial, qpython – Python Tutorial and also An Introduction to Python for Android Development – Python Pool. Here it is:
Sl4a – Python Tutorial
pythonspot.com
python android install
Run Python On Android – How To Run Python Programs On Android
www.simplifiedpython.net
Qpython – Python Tutorial
pythonspot.com
python
Python 3 For Android – Download
python-3.en.softonic.com
Android Studio Python – Gikda
gikda.weebly.com
An Introduction To Python For Android Development – Python Pool
www.pythonpool.com
Python 3 For Android – Download
python-3.en.softonic.com
Can I Install Python On Android? – Techris Innovation Hub
techris.in
Can I Install Python On Android? – Techris Innovation Hub
techris.in
Run Python On Android – How To Run Python Programs On Android
www.simplifiedpython.net
install libraries
Run python on android. Python 3 for android. Android studio python